Good morning, friends. I thought that sharing this link might interest many people. This could be a significant issue for my business, and I believe for yours as well. For instance, to consistently stay in the 3-packs, will we be forced to lie about our actual opening and closing hours? If a user, comfortably in bed at 3:00 AM, searches for a 'shower maintenance' service with the intention to call at 9:30 AM, they won't find the business—even if you're ranked first throughout the entire opening and closing hours!
